Nếu bạn đang xây dựng một website bán hàng bằng WordPress, chắc chắn bạn sẽ cần một tính năng quan trọng: tạo giỏ hàng trong WordPress. Giỏ hàng là công cụ giúp người dùng thêm sản phẩm, tính tổng giá trị đơn hàng và thực hiện thanh toán một cách thuận tiện. Trong bài viết này, bạn sẽ được hướng dẫn toàn diện cách tạo và tối ưu giỏ hàng trong WordPress.
Giỏ hàng (shopping cart) là một tính năng không thể thiếu trong các website thương mại điện tử. Khi bạn tạo giỏ hàng trong WordPress, người dùng sẽ có thể:
Thêm sản phẩm vào giỏ tạm thời.
Xem lại số lượng và chi tiết sản phẩm đã chọn.
Tính toán tổng hóa đơn và chi phí vận chuyển.
Tiến hành thanh toán một cách tự động.
Tính năng này đặc biệt quan trọng trong trải nghiệm mua sắm online, giúp tăng tỷ lệ chuyển đổi và sự hài lòng của khách hàng.
2.1 Tăng trải nghiệm người dùng
Giỏ hàng giúp người dùng dễ dàng kiểm soát sản phẩm đã chọn và thay đổi khi cần. Điều này làm cho quá trình mua hàng trở nên linh hoạt và thuận tiện hơn.
2.2 Hỗ trợ quá trình thanh toán
Bạn không thể thiết lập một hệ thống bán hàng trọn vẹn nếu thiếu giỏ hàng. Đây là điểm trung gian giữa việc chọn sản phẩm và thanh toán.
2.3 Tối ưu chuyển đổi và doanh thu
Giỏ hàng chuyên nghiệp giúp giảm tỷ lệ bỏ giỏ và tăng khả năng thanh toán thành công. Nhiều plugin hỗ trợ tính năng nhắc nhở khi người dùng rời bỏ giỏ hàng.
Để tạo giỏ hàng trong WordPress, bạn cần cài đặt các plugin hỗ trợ. Dưới đây là một số lựa chọn phổ biến:
3.1 WooCommerce
Đây là plugin mạnh mẽ và phổ biến nhất hiện nay để xây dựng website bán hàng trên WordPress. WooCommerce tích hợp sẵn giỏ hàng và các tính năng như thanh toán, vận chuyển, quản lý đơn hàng.
3.2 Easy Digital Downloads (EDD)
Phù hợp cho các website bán sản phẩm kỹ thuật số như e-book, phần mềm. EDD có chức năng giỏ hàng nhẹ, đơn giản, dễ dùng.
3.3 Cart66 Cloud
Giải pháp giỏ hàng kết hợp với bảo mật, tích hợp thanh toán và marketing automation. Phù hợp cho người dùng có ít kiến thức kỹ thuật.
Bước 1: Cài đặt WooCommerce
Truy cập trang quản trị WordPress > Plugin > Thêm mới.
Gõ "WooCommerce" và nhấn Cài đặt.
Kích hoạt plugin sau khi cài xong.
Bước 2: Cấu hình cửa hàng
Chọn quốc gia, loại tiền tệ, đơn vị vận chuyển.
Kết nối cổng thanh toán như Stripe, PayPal.
Bước 3: Thêm sản phẩm
Vào Sản phẩm > Thêm mới.
Điền tiêu đề, mô tả, ảnh sản phẩm, giá.
Bước 4: Tạo trang giỏ hàng và thanh toán
WooCommerce sẽ tự động tạo các trang: Giỏ hàng, Thanh toán, Tài khoản của tôi.
Kiểm tra và thêm các trang này vào menu chính.
Bước 5: Kiểm tra hoạt động của giỏ hàng
Thử thêm sản phẩm vào giỏ.
Kiểm tra xem tổng giá, số lượng có hiển thị chính xác không.
Tiến hành thanh toán để chắc chắn mọi bước hoạt động trơn tru.
5.1 Sử dụng theme hỗ trợ WooCommerce
Hầu hết các theme hiện đại đều có thiết kế giỏ hàng đẹp mắt và tương thích tốt với WooCommerce. Bạn nên chọn theme có đánh giá cao và cập nhật thường xuyên.
Bước 1: Truy cập Giao diện > Giao diện mới và tìm kiếm các theme có hỗ trợ WooCommerce (ví dụ: Astra, OceanWP, Storefront).
Bước 2: Cài đặt và kích hoạt theme. Các theme này đã tối ưu sẵn hiển thị giỏ hàng nên bạn không cần chỉnh sửa nhiều.
5.2 Tùy biến bằng CSS hoặc trình dựng trang
Bạn có thể sử dụng trình chỉnh sửa như Elementor hoặc các đoạn CSS để thay đổi:
Màu sắc, bố cục giỏ hàng.
Nút "Thêm vào giỏ", "Xem giỏ hàng".
Hiển thị hình ảnh sản phẩm trong giỏ.
Bước 1: Nếu dùng Elementor, hãy tạo một template mới (Giao diện > Theme Builder).
Bước 2: Chèn các widget như "WooCommerce Cart", "Product Grid", "Checkout".
Bước 3: Kéo thả để chỉnh vị trí nút "Thêm vào giỏ", ảnh sản phẩm, bảng tóm tắt giỏ hàng.
5.3 Cài plugin hỗ trợ giao diện giỏ hàng
Plugin gợi ý: WooCommerce Cart Abandonment Recovery, Side Cart WooCommerce, WooCommerce Customizer.
Cách dùng: Cài đặt > Kích hoạt > Tùy chỉnh các cài đặt hiển thị của plugin đó.
Các plugin này có thể thêm hiệu ứng popup giỏ hàng, giỏ hàng bên cạnh, icon động để tăng trải nghiệm người dùng.
6.1 Không hiển thị nút giỏ hàng
Lỗi này thường do theme không hỗ trợ WooCommerce hoặc bị thiếu shortcode. Để khắc phục, bạn có thể:
Kiểm tra xem theme có tương thích WooCommerce không.
Thêm shortcode [woocommerce_cart] hoặc [woocommerce_checkout] vào trang cần hiển thị.
6.2 Không cập nhật số lượng trong giỏ
Một lỗi phổ biến khi giỏ hàng không thay đổi số lượng sau khi người dùng nhấn cập nhật. Nguyên nhân có thể do:
Xung đột với plugin cache hoặc bảo mật.
Lỗi JavaScript trong theme hoặc plugin. Bạn nên thử:
Tạm thời tắt các plugin không cần thiết.
Xóa cache trình duyệt và cache của website.
6.3 Lỗi trong quá trình thanh toán
Thường xuất hiện do cấu hình sai cổng thanh toán hoặc phiên bản WooCommerce không tương thích. Cách xử lý:
Kiểm tra lại thông tin cấu hình của cổng thanh toán (PayPal, Stripe,...).
Cập nhật WooCommerce và plugin thanh toán lên phiên bản mới nhất.
Kiểm tra lỗi trong tab "WooCommerce > Trạng thái hệ thống".
6.4 Giỏ hàng trống sau khi thêm sản phẩm
Đây là lỗi liên quan đến session hoặc cookie. Người dùng thêm sản phẩm nhưng khi vào trang giỏ hàng thì trống. Nguyên nhân:
Cookie không được lưu do thiết lập sai.
Plugin cache loại bỏ session người dùng. Khắc phục bằng cách cấu hình lại cache và đảm bảo site đang chạy ở chế độ HTTPS ổn định.
7.1 Tích hợp thanh toán nhanh (Quick Checkout)
Giảm số bước cần thiết để hoàn tất đơn hàng sẽ giúp giảm tỷ lệ từ bỏ giỏ hàng. Bạn có thể sử dụng plugin như "WooCommerce One Page Checkout" để người dùng vừa chọn hàng vừa thanh toán trên cùng một trang.
7.2 Hiển thị rõ ràng chi phí vận chuyển và thuế
Nhiều người dùng từ bỏ giỏ hàng khi phát hiện thêm chi phí phát sinh vào bước cuối. Hãy minh bạch ngay từ đầu bằng cách tính toán phí vận chuyển và thuế trong giỏ hàng.
7.3 Tạo tính năng "Lưu giỏ hàng cho lần sau"
Giúp người mua có thể quay lại website và tiếp tục quá trình mua sắm mà không phải chọn lại sản phẩm từ đầu. Bạn có thể dùng plugin hỗ trợ chức năng "Save Cart".
7.4 Tích hợp nhắc nhở khi bỏ giỏ hàng (Cart Abandonment Recovery)
Sử dụng plugin gửi email nhắc nhở hoặc popup hiển thị nếu người dùng không hoàn tất thanh toán. Ví dụ: "Cart Abandonment Recovery for WooCommerce" có thể gửi email tự động sau 1-2 giờ khi người dùng thoát trang mà chưa thanh toán.
7.5 Tối ưu hiển thị giỏ hàng trên thiết bị di động
Rất nhiều người mua hàng bằng điện thoại, nên bạn cần đảm bảo giỏ hàng:
Có nút truy cập nhanh ở góc màn hình.
Hiển thị dễ đọc, không lỗi font, dễ thao tác chạm.
Việc tạo giỏ hàng trong WordPress là bước quan trọng để xây dựng một hệ thống bán hàng hiệu quả và chuyên nghiệp. Dù bạn chỉ bán vài sản phẩm đơn giản hay xây dựng một cửa hàng quy mô lớn, tính năng giỏ hàng luôn cần được ưu tiên. Hãy lựa chọn công cụ phù hợp, tối ưu trải nghiệm người dùng và luôn kiểm tra kỹ để tránh lỗi phát sinh. Với hướng dẫn chi tiết trên, bạn đã sẵn sàng tạo một website bán hàng hoàn chỉnh trên nền tảng WordPress.